What is the cheapest flight to England?

These are the best return prices found by users searching on KAYAK in the last 72 hours.
The cheapest ticket to England from Jamaica found in the last 72 hours was to London Gatwick Airport, at £407 return. The most popular route is Kingston (KIN) to London Gatwick Airport (LGW) and the cheapest return airline ticket found on this route in the last 72 hours was £407.

What is the cheapest day to fly to England?

The average price of all flights from Jamaica to England cl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to England is Sunday when return tickets can be as cheap as £755.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Thursday, when return prices are £810 on average.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Jamaica to England?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Jamaica to England,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Jamaica to England is December, when tickets cost £730 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are February and September,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is £933 and £867 respectively.

What is the cheapest time of day to fly to England?

The average price for all round-trip flights from Jamaica to England depending on the time of departure, clicked by users on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.
The cheapest time of day to fly to England is generally in the morning, when round-trip flights cost £914 on average. Morning departures are around 10% cheaper than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to England is generally at night,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is £1,104.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Jamaica to England?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ights to England,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.
To get a below-average price on the flight from Jamaica to England,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 26 weeks before departure.

Which is the cheapest airport to fly into in England?

Prices will differ depending on the departure airport, but generally, the cheapest airport to fly to in England is London Heathrow Airport (LHR), with an average flight price of £482.
